Main allergens in cats and dogs

The proteins attached to fur, dander, and saliva cause animal allergies, rather than the fur itself. The main allergens have different names and come from different places: cats produce Fel d 1, while dogs produce Can f 1 and Can f 5.

Uteroglobin, lipocalin, and kallikrein are protein families.

Fel d 1 is the first allergen identified from cats (Felis domesticus), and Can f 1 is the first identified from dogs (Canis familiaris).

Fel d 1 in cats

Up to 95% of people with cat allergies react to Fel d 1. Cats produce it in their sebaceous and salivary glands, and grooming spreads it through the fur.

It travels on particles smaller than 5 micrometers (0.005 millimeters), which can float in the air. Those fine particles can reach deep into the nose and bronchi, and Thermo Fisher’s encyclopedia associates them with asthma.
Even homes without cats can contain more than 8 micrograms of Fel d 1 per gram of dust, a level the encyclopedia describes as a marker of sensitization (detectable allergen-specific IgE, which doesn’t necessarily cause symptoms). Clothing can carry it indoors.
The encyclopedia says symptoms may take months to settle after a cat is removed from a home.

Male and female cats differ, too. Neutering reduces Fel d 1 production to about one-third to one-fifth, suggesting a role for testosterone, a male sex hormone.
The encyclopedia says no cat is hypoallergenic: all living cats produce Fel d 1 regardless of sex, environment, breed, or age.

Can f 1 and Can f 5 in dogs

The WHO/IUIS registry lists eight dog allergens, from Can f 1 through Can f 8. Can f 1, 2, 4, and 6 are lipocalins.
About half of people with dog allergies react to Can f 1. It is secreted by sebaceous glands and gets onto fur, dander, and saliva.

Can f 5 is a prostate enzyme identified in 2009. In a paper by Mattsson and colleagues, serum from 26 of 37 people with dog allergies (70%) reacted to Can f 5. Of those 26, 14 did not react to Can f 1, 2, or 3. Because it is produced in the prostate, Can f 5 appears in male dogs’ urine and can also get onto their fur and dander.
According to the encyclopedia, people who react only to Can f 5 sometimes do not react to female dogs or neutered males.

I also wondered whether breed makes a difference. Vredegoor and colleagues’ 2012 study compared Can f 1 on the fur and in the household dust of breeds marketed as hypoallergenic—Labradoodles, Poodles, Spanish Water Dogs, and Airedale Terriers—with Labrador Retrievers and a control group.
The supposedly hypoallergenic breeds actually had more Can f 1 on their fur, while the study found no breed difference in the amount in household air.
Differences between breeds were smaller than differences between individual dogs of the same breed. The measurements did not support classifying any tested breed as hypoallergenic.

Why cats might be fine while dogs bother me

Different main allergens mean a person can be sensitized to one animal but not the other. Having no symptoms around a cat does not tell me whether I am sensitized to Fel d 1. My eye symptoms around dogs don’t tell me which dog protein, if any, is responsible.

Some cat and dog proteins are similar, though. Dog Can f 6 and cat Fel d 4 are both lipocalins. Their amino acid sequences are 67% identical, and the two proteins cross-react enough to inhibit each other’s IgE responses (Can f 6).
Can f 1 and cat Fel d 7 are also 62% identical, and the source says they may cross-react. This may be one reason some people become sensitized to both cats and dogs.
Having no symptoms around cats does not rule out sensitization to Fel d 4 and Can f 6.

The ImmunoCAP test list includes blood tests that measure specific IgE to Can f 1, 2, 3, 5, and 6 individually. Test results alone do not establish the cause; a doctor considers medical history and symptoms as well. Which tests are available also varies by country and laboratory.
If someone is sensitized only to Can f 5, their symptoms may differ between intact male dogs and female or neutered male dogs.
